When is the cheapest time to fly to Rome?

Rome is a destination where flight prices from Turkey significantly drop, especially between April and October. During these months, the weather is mild, and the tourist crowds in the city decrease. As a result, both accommodation and flight prices become more affordable compared to peak seasons.

In the summer months, particularly in July and August, prices generally rise due to Rome's tourist appeal. It is also observed that flight prices increase during high-demand periods such as school holidays and festive seasons. Therefore, you can experience a more economical travel experience by planning your trip away from these times.

💡 How to book Rome cheaper

  • 1. Try to be flexible with your travel dates; midweek flights can often help you find better prices.
  • 2. Purchasing your tickets at least 6-8 weeks in advance can help you secure better rates.
  • 3. Check alternative airports; there may be price differences between Fiumicino and Ciampino airports in Rome.
  • 4. Early morning or late-night flights can often lead to lower prices.

How far in advance should I book my flight?
For the best prices, we recommend booking your tickets approximately 6-8 weeks in advance.
What is the most expensive period for flights to Rome?
The summer months, particularly July and August, are considered the most expensive times.
Which months have the most affordable prices?
April and October are the months when flight prices are the most affordable.
